Transaction 8e010df58ae4aef6741a69a14e4af949993b7a473e045aeac8460a6801921782
2 Input
2 Outputs
- 8e010df58ae4aef6741a69a14e4af949993b7a473e045aeac8460a6801921782:0
- 8e010df58ae4aef6741a69a14e4af949993b7a473e045aeac8460a6801921782:1
value 69566758
address 39uYtY5w8imSki4LyeFohrTmrEwfpUdGaq
value 10301726
address 1BwGUtHirPQ4dKusbCTcxMbxBTu24yRkHa